Turquoise halo around the Chatham Islands reveals a phytoplankton bloom shaped by an underwater plateau

TL;DR Summary
NASA’s VIIRS-equipped NOAA-20 satellite captured a bright turquoise ring around New Zealand’s Chatham Islands, caused by a summer phytoplankton bloom whose pattern is shaped by the long underwater Chatham Rise. The surface view shows how light, nutrients, currents and seafloor geography create the halo, but scientists still need direct water sampling to identify the species and confirm the exact drivers; blooms like this can influence the wider marine ecosystem around the islands.
